Jack Tremain is an architect whose project brings him back to LA after a long absence. Unhappy at being in a place full of bad memories, Jack is stunned to run into the woman who caused his unhappiness. As they have a drink and reminisce, Jack confronts Kate, and through a series of flashbacks, we learn their story. As Jack comes to terms with his anger at Kate for ending the relationship, Kate succumbs to her feelings and they share a romantic interlude. Through one last night together, Jack is able to find closure, but for Kate it only tears open old wounds.
William Petersen and Anne Archer are both perfection in this Showtime short directed by Richard Dreyfuss. The chemistry between the two actors makes for a deeply involving story.
